Last year Action Medical Research raised more than £60,000 as it sent out more than 10,000 cream-teas-in-a-box packed by its army of volunteers. That was a total of 20,740 scones!

For 2016, the mouth-watering Action Cream Teas - which come in a box priced just £6 - will again contain two freshly baked scones perfect for piling high with oozing strawberry jam and clotted cream, ready to be washed down with a refreshing cup of tea.

Research is the key to saving many children from a lifetime of suffering, yet surprisingly, medical research into conditions that devastate children’s lives is poorly funded.

With the help of its supporters, Action Medical Research has played a significant role in many medical breakthroughs since it began in 1952, from the development of the first UK polio vaccines to the use of ultrasound in pregnancy.

It is currently funding research into meningitis, Down syndrome, epilepsy and premature birth, as well as some rare and distressing conditions that severely affect children.
